Setting a Realistic Budget for Your Restoration
A well-defined budget is vital for any kind of cooking area remodelling, as it offers as a roadmap for managing expenditures throughout the project. Property owners must start by examining their financial capacity and setting a reasonable costs restriction. It is essential to make up all possible prices, including materials, labor, permits, and unexpected expenditures that might emerge. A contingency fund, usually 10-20% of the complete spending plan, can aid address unexpected issues.Researching standard costs for various components, such as counter tops, closets, and home appliances, enables house owners to make educated decisions (kitchen renovations london ontario). Focusing on functions based upon requirement versus luxury can likewise help in adhering to the spending plan. Additionally, getting multiple quotes from specialists can provide a more clear picture of labor expenses and aid prevent overspending. On the whole, a meticulously prepared budget guarantees that the renovation procedure stays convenient and aligned with financial goals, inevitably leading to a successful kitchen transformation

Building Timeline Overview
Comprehending the construction timeline is important for property owners commencing on a cooking area remodelling. This timeline generally extends a number of weeks, starting with demolition, which might take a couple of days. Adhering to demolition, the professional will certainly address any type of essential structural modifications, framing, and electrical or pipes updates, typically happening within one to two weeks. Next off, the setup of cabinets, counter tops, and devices takes spotlight and can last from one to 3 weeks, depending upon the intricacy of the design. Ending up touches, such as painting and floor covering, will normally adhere to, wrapping up the improvement procedure. House owners need to continue to be adaptable, as unanticipated hold-ups can occur. Overall, a well-structured timeline aids guarantee a efficient and smooth renovation experience.

How Lengthy Does a Typical Cooking Area Restoration Take?
The duration of a common kitchen renovation differs, normally varying from several weeks to a couple of months. Factors influencing this timeline consist of project intricacy, style options, and the availability of materials and labor.

How Can I Minimize Disruption During Renovations?
To reduce disturbance during Renovations, people can develop a momentary kitchen area room, establish clear communication with service providers, established sensible timelines, and schedule work throughout less invasive hours, making certain day-to-day routines continue to be as unaffected as feasible.
What Prevail Blunders to Prevent in Kitchen Renovations?
Typical mistakes in cooking area Renovations commonly include underestimating budgets, neglecting adequate planning, neglecting lighting requirements, stopping working to assess process, and selecting stylish materials that might not endure time, ultimately bring about dissatisfaction and costly reworks.
